  1. a [Sample frequency]/[Background frequency]
  2. bSampled genes exclude hypothetical proteins with no assigned function.
  3. SIDER-associated orthologs were separated into 7 distinct subgroups for Gene Ontology term enrichment using AmigGO [38]. The unique corresponding L. major orthologs with annotated GO terms in each subgroup were sampled against a background of all functionally annotated genes in L. major. Only P-values ≤ 10-2 (rmq: most of the values are between 10-2 and 10-3) and over 1.5× enrichment are presented. n/a: not applicable.
